Former President Barack Obama gave a blistering critique of his White Home successor Donald Trump and urged Black males to point out up for Kamala Harris as he campaigned in Pittsburgh on Thursday firstly of a swing-state tour for the Democratic ticket.

At a marketing campaign subject workplace to thank volunteers, Obama mentioned he wished to “converse some truths” after listening to experiences on the bottom that there was decrease enthusiasm for Harris than there was for his personal candidacy and that some Black males had been pondering of sitting out the election.

“A part of it makes me suppose — and I’m chatting with males straight — a part of it makes me suppose that, effectively, you simply aren’t feeling the concept of getting a girl as president, and also you’re arising with different options and different causes for that,” Obama mentioned.

The previous president mentioned Trump’s penchant for placing folks down was not actual energy.

“You’re serious about sitting out or supporting anyone who has a historical past of denigrating you, since you suppose that’s an indication of energy, as a result of that’s what being a person is? Placing ladies down? That’s not acceptable,” Obama mentioned.

The Democratic former president made the battleground state of Pennsylvania the primary cease of his marketing campaign tour with lower than 4 weeks till Election Day and as voting is already underway. Talking at a rally on the College of Pittsburgh, he painted Trump as out-of-touch and never the selection to steer the nation to alter, calling him a “bumbling” billionaire “who has not stopped whining about his issues since he rode down his golden escalator 9 years in the past.”

He mentioned Harris is “a frontrunner who has spent her life combating on behalf of people that want a voice and an opportunity” and declared, “Kamala is as ready for the job as any nominee for president has ever been.”

Because the nation’s first Black president, Obama’s look for Harris underscores the history-making nature of her personal political profession. Harris, the primary girl, Black particular person or particular person of South Asian descent to function vp, could be the primary girl to function president if elected subsequent month.

His outdated marketing campaign rallying cry, “Sure, We Can,” was even refashioned for the occasion, with “Sure, She Can” beaming on a display over the gang.

Each Harris and Trump have been vying for help from Black People. A current ballot from the  AP-NORC Heart for Public Affairs Analysis discovered that about 7 in 10 Black voters have a considerably or very favorable view of Harris, with few variations between Black female and male voters on how they view the Democratic candidate.

Black voters’ opinions of Trump, in contrast, had been overwhelmingly destructive, in line with the ballot, however the former president believes his message on the economic system, immigration and conventional values could make inroads into the Democrats’ conventional base of help amongst Black voters, particularly youthful Black males.

Obama was among the many key Democrats who had been a part of a behind-the-scenes effort to encourage Biden, his former vp, to drop out of the 2024 race.

Obama and Harris have been mates for 20 years since he ran for Senate in Illinois. She campaigned for him when he sought the presidency in 2008.

Pennsylvania is a state Obama gained in his 2008 and 2012 presidential races, however Trump gained in 2016. Biden narrowly carried it in 2020 and the state is shaping as much as be probably the most carefully contested on this 12 months’s race.

Trump was within the japanese a part of the state Wednesday for back-to-back rallies in Scranton and Studying. He additionally campaigned in japanese Pennsylvania over the weekend when he returned to Butler, the place he was shot in July as he survived an assassination try.

Obama’s look on the College of Pittsburgh was additionally aimed to bolster the reelection marketing campaign of Pennsylvania Sen. Bob Casey, who’s being challenged by Trump-endorsed Republican David McCormick.
